Bilstein_00333 Northrop Gamma 2B NR12269 on Lake Elsinore 1934

  • Kerry Taylor said:
    Info from aerialvisuals.ca Northrop Gamma 2B NR12269 MSN 2 By 1934 To Lincoln Ellsworth Expedition with c/r NR12269. Operated with markings: Polar Star. Used by explorer Lincoln Ellsworth and pilot Herbert Hollick-Kenyon for Antarctic exploration, culminating in a trans-Antarctic flight from Dundee Island to the Little America station, with five stops, in November-December 1935. They reportedly attempted to reach the South Pole, but made a forced landing only 25 miles short of the pole. The aircraft was recovered a year later and donated to the National Air and Space Museum in Washington, DC, where it is on display, and is the only Gamma in existence today.
